High Wind Watch Issued for Wednesday

A High Wind Watch has been issued by the National Weather Service for northwest Missouri and southwest Iowa beginning Wednesday morning and lasting through Wednesday evening.

Southwest winds will continue through the day ranging from 25 to 35 mph with gusts up to 65 mph.

Impacts include damaging winds that could blow down trees and power lines.  Widespread power outages are possible.  Travel could be difficult, especially for high profile vehicles.

A few thunderstorms are possible Wednesday evening.  While chances are not high at this time, if storms develop they could be strong to severe.
